If you're receiving complimentary treatment, Nguyen notes, you still have a say when it involves choosing a therapist. Ask for info regarding the various providers offered and choose the one that really feels like the very best fit. If you are used, another totally free choice worth checking out is if your work environment supplies an EAP, or staff member aid program.

You can look by concern, like "depression," "dependency" or "marriage therapy," or by sort of treatment. You can additionally search by age, gender, ethnic culture, language, sexuality, and insurance coverage approved. Main treatment medical professionals and various other healthcare companies, as well as family members and friends may be able to recommend providers, says Bufka.

On the other hand, Lynn Bufka claims that if a specialist doesn't disclose much either in their internet existence or in conversation with a customer that's a legitimate professional selection not a warning.

While it can be meaningful to deal with a specialist from a comparable background, Nguyen advises prioritizing matching objectives over race or ethnic group in your search specifically because the need for therapy is so high now. Some therapists supply brief appointments for free, normally about 15 mins. Nguyen recommends coming to a consultation or an initial visit with a set of questions.

"Can I expect to see gains after a certain amount of time? What might that resemble? Is the type of therapy that you offer something that's supported by the research?" Take notice of their responses virtually as if you got on a date.
While finding a specialist who you feel you can open up to is a terrific start, a vital element of therapy is time, Nguyen says. "You shouldn't presume it's going to be magical," she says.
